The White Company – Day & Night Fragrance
The first thing inside the box are two little perfume samples from The White Company. The Day & Night fragrances ooze Autumn! The 'Day' scent is a described to be "like walking through a sun-drenched orchard on a crisp Autumn morning". There are notes of Jasmine, Apple, Cedarwood and Bergamot. The 'Night' scent is a stronger, darker scent combining "notes of pomegranate, cassis and patchouli with a soft vanilla base to create this seductive and sophisticated scent". The scents come in two sizes; both a handy 30ml size (£30) and 100ml (£70).

Revlon Colorstay Gel Envy Nail Enamel & Colorstay Gel Diamond Top Coat
I could not resist choosing this nail duo from Revlon. I actually have already tried some polishes from this range, but I haven't tried the Diamond Top coat which is on my wish list. The Revlon Gel Envy Nail Enamel is a 2 step gel manicure routine, which aims to give amazing colour, paired high-shine gel finish. They are both full sized bottles which retail for £6.99 a pop, so it's amazing to get them both in a £6.95 box! 

Eyes Of Horus Goddess Mascara
Eyes Of Horus is a new brand to me, but I can never resist trying a new mascara. It's actually a pretty pricey brand, so I'm actually expecting great things. The mascara contains Organic Moringa Oil, which is ideal for sensitive eyes! It aims to strengthen and lengthen, without clumping, running and smudging.
